Racing enthusiasts will aner again the spacious premises of the Hongkong Jockey Club at Happy Valley tomorrow afternoon when the SEVENTH EXTRA RACE MEETING takes place. The pro- gramme originally called for 10 events but in view of the number of entries received (34) for the Gosford Handicap over six furiosigs for "C" Class Australians, the Stewards have divided the race into ibree sections instead of two as specified on the draft programme, and this extra event will be run as the last race of the meeting al 1.50 p.m.

Speaking at the meeting of the Legislative Council yester- day afternoon. the HON. MR. T. £ PEARCE moved an amend- ment to Clause of an Ordinance to amend the Betting Duty Ordinance. 1931, as amended by the Betting Duty Amendment Ordinance, 1948, to read: "This Ordinance shall come into force on the 1st day of October, 1941, and shall continue in force on- til the war, which began on Sept. 3. 1939, is terminated, and no longer, unless otherwise provided by Ordinance.”
The Attorney General Hon. Mr. C G. Alabaster, K.C.) said that the amendment had been considered by the Governor in Conuri but it was regretted that the amendment could not be accepted.
